Hi Michelle - I remember it the way Jane teaches it in one of the videos (probably the first twill lesson) .She has you go over the floating selvedge thread with the tip of your shuttle when entering the shed, and going under the floating selvedge coming out by lifting it slightly with your receiving hand. I’m a beginner, but by sticking to this I find it second nature and don’t even think about it. I hope this helps!
